WebDeer meat is a nutritious option. A three-ounce cut of deer meat has 134 calories and three grams of fat. The same amount of beef has 259 calories and 18 grams of fat, … WebPrevention. If CWD could spread to people, it would most likely be through eating of infected deer and elk. In a 2006-2007 CDC survey of U.S. residents, nearly 20 percent of those surveyed said they had hunted deer or elk and more than two-thirds said they had eaten venison or elk meat. However, to date, there is no strong evidence for the ...

WebMar 8, 2024 · Final Thoughts. Venison is the meat from deer, including animals in the deer family such as elk, reindeer, caribou and antelope. It’s lower in calories and fat than beef and has a similar but richer, more earthy flavor. Deer meat is high in many important nutrients, including vitamin B12, zinc and niacin.
